					<description><![CDATA[In a groundbreaking study, researchers have uncovered the intricate transcriptional networks that govern sperm motility differences in various Chinese indigenous chicken breeds. This work not only advances our understanding of avian reproductive biology but also has implications for poultry breeding practices and genetic selection.
